Without leaving a trace
No connection to Skype? Then try to completely get rid of this program, and then reinstall it. The problem, as a rule, lies in the absolute erasure of the application from the "face" of the system. Sometimes this is not so easy. Especially if you are a novice user and do not know where the folders that remain after the standard deletion are stored. Let's try to figure out with you what to do in a similar situation.
So, the first thing you will have to use the "Control Panel". Find us "Add or Remove Programs" and click on this item. Now, if you encounter the described problem in the Skype application (it was not possible to establish a connection to the Internet), then just find the appropriate program and delete it. It would seem that all. But no. After that, you will have to clean up some more places in order to ensure absolute cleaning of the system from the application.
Go to the search. Type Appdata / Skype there. You will be "thrown" to the page where some information about the remote Skype will be stored. Great, this is what we need! Just remove this daddy and then empty the basket. It is best to restart your computer after the removal is complete. Next, you need to download the latest version of Skype (the newer, the better), and then just install it, following the instructions written in the installer. Now try to connect - everything should work.

Many downloads
True, it is now worth discussing with you a more pleasant moment, which may be related to our current problem. It is about downloading files from the Internet to your computer. Quite often, this is precisely the problem of connecting the application. Why? Let's get it right.
When we connect one or another tariff plan to the Internet, we are given a certain speed. It is redistributed when we begin to interact with the World Wide Web. Downloading files is what the emphasis is on when working. Especially if you decide to use some kind of torrent for this purpose. He generally takes all the speed.
If you have a problem in which the Skype system could not establish a connection, check if you have a torrent client running and also if you have a large number of file downloads. If the answer is yes, either wait until the end of this process, or pause downloading files. Speed will be redistributed, and everything will work.
